Terraced two-bay three-storey house, c.1875, with shopfront to ground floor. Pitched roof with materials not visible, rendered chimney stack, and cast-iron rainwater goods on rendered eaves having iron brackets. Painted rendered, ruled and lined walls with rendered channelled piers to ends. Square-headed window openings with cut-stone sills, moulded rendered surrounds, and one-over-one timber sash windows. Timber shopfront to ground floor with pilasters, fixed-pane timber display windows, glazed timber panelled door having overlight, fascia having consoles, and moulded cornice. Interior with timber panelled shutters to window openings. Road fronted with concrete footpath to front.
